Nonlinear Thinking: FAA Approves First Flying Car

Alef Aeronautics’ flying car has been given a special airworthiness certification from the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A), meaning the company will be allowed to road/air test the car, the company said in a news release.  The fully electric vehicle (with a hydrogen … Continue reading

U.S. Budget Deficit Nearing 8% Of GDP

The U.S. budget deficit keeps climbing, approaching 8 percent of GDP as the 12-month trailing shortfall reached $2.1 trillion in May.  Budget receipts in May were down 20 percent year-on-year, most likely due to lower tax receipts from a slowing … Continue reading
